Description
In response to the Army STTR Topic A14A-T015 solicitation for tunable high-power LWIR lasers for standoff detection applications, Pranalytica proposes to develop a compact, rugged and highly reliable wavelength tunable quantum cascade laser (QCL) module delivering over 5W of peak power and over 0.5W of average power in the spectral region spanning from 7 to 11µm. The proposed approach is based on a new external cavity configuration, not used for QCLs heretofore, and offers several critical advantages, over either the QCL arrays or the traditional grating external cavity QCL, for practical field applications, including rapid wavelength tuning, high manufacturing yield, and compatibility with standard QCL packaging. Unprecedented combination of the projected operational characteristics of the module will pave the way to a new generation of standoff detection systems.
